logo

Output ef54d171f80222998c0111f0919faeb67f8e1aef0099ca4164059ab47bda56d8:0

value
39407641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ce76fb6991ba8156aa1d7f926dcaa6f046a2ca1 OP_EQUAL
address
35nSuTyUyRPWC9gWRQRX3pmp6GbUUTWRLD
transaction
ef54d171f80222998c0111f0919faeb67f8e1aef0099ca4164059ab47bda56d8